WebApr 6, 2024 · A sitz bath with warm water is the most common form of physical therapy. Sitz baths with warm water refer to temperature hyperthermia for the prostate, which can raise the patient's pelvic temperature, promoting peripheral muscle relaxation and relieving pelvic floor muscle spasms. One benefit of aquatic therapy is the buoyancy provided by the water. While submerged in water, buoyancy assists in supporting the weight of the patient. This decreases the amount of weight bearing which reduces the force of stress placed on the joints.
